Despite widespread reports of turmoil in the UK property market, including buy-to-let, investors should look at the figures in perspective.
That is according to Paul Weller, managing director of local letting specialist Leaders, who maintained that the various statistics which are being published do not give an accurate picture of the overall market.
He noted, for example, that while a slight fall in south-east rents is indicated by the latest quarterly report from Arla, the areas his company covers have actually experienced increases over the last three months.
Mr Weller commented: "In any given period of time, rents on some property types may be falling in some areas because of oversupply, whilst other property types may be in greater demand and show significant rent increases.
"These details are never reflected in average figures, which is why you need to speak to a local specialist who knows your market inside out."
